Furthermore, a party moving for summary judgment must serve all evidence that supports its motion at least 20 days before a summary judgment hearing. Code §§ 210, 403. In Barak v. The Quisenberry Law Firm, 135 Cal.App.4th 654 (2006), the court noted that "when a party merely joins in a motion for summary judgment without presenting its own evidence, the party fails to establish the necessary factual foundation to support the motion"…and that "joining in an argument is different from joining in a motion." Chowdhary (State Bar No. The Supreme Court explained in Celotex Corp. v. Catrett, 477 U.S. 317 (1986), that a party can obtain for summary judgment when its opponent has no evidence to support an element of the opponent's case.Justice Brennan's dissent warned then that the opinion would "create confusion" among district courts. Many attorneys will file a motion for summary judgement as if it is a discovery motion - relying solely on the existence of the evidence rather than the admissibility of the evidence. Evidence in support of a motion for summary judgment included the declaration based on information and belief of a lawyer representing the moving party in which he avers he has "personal knowledge of the foregoing, except as to those matters stated on information and belief."
